Having been spoiled by silicone tending not to stick to anything whatsoever, I made a rather important polyurethane mold, that encased eight sla-printed, hand-finished masters, without a release agent ...rather painful way of learning that polyurethane is an EXCELLENT adhesive.
Probably my most expensive paperweight to date 😂
